  The research at Micro and Nanosystems focuses on Microelectromechanical Systems (MEMS) and its applications in the medical (MedMEMS), biotechnology (BioMEMS), optical (OptoMEMS) and radio frequency (RFMEMS) fields. The department staff consists of ~45 faculty members, researchers and PhD students who contribute to a high professional standard of intensive work and quality results, as well as to a friendly and open environment. The staff has a multicultural background and the working language is English. The department is internationally well established, has many research collaborations with excellent partners worldwide, and is involved in several European and national projects.

  Project description

  In the group "In vitro neural models" we are combining micro engineering with human primary cells and stem cell-derived cells to create models of the nervous system useful for fundamental biological mechanistic studies as well as compound evaluation. This project will be combining neural models with real-time sensing of neural function, barrier function and metabolic activity. Conventional cell culture, as well as microfluidic Organ-on-Chip methods will be applied. The post doc scholarship will focus on electrophysiological measurement in Brain-on-Chip systems. The project will partially be carried out in collaboration with Karolinska Institutet, Swedish Medical Nanoscience center.
